When try command ./trinity -L , got some syscalls have 3 entrypoint , e.g:
32-bit entrypoint 28 fstatfs : Enabled
32-bit entrypoint 100 fstatfs : Enabled
64-bit entrypoint 138 fstatfs : Enabled
...
32-bit entrypoint 109 uname : Enabled
32-bit entrypoint 122 uname : Enabled
64-bit entrypoint 63 uname : Enabled
...
32-bit entrypoint 187 sendfile : Enabled
32-bit entrypoint 239 sendfile : Enabled
64-bit entrypoint 40 sendfile : Enabled
...
32-bit entrypoint 82 select : Enabled AVOID
32-bit entrypoint 142 select : Enabled AVOID
64-bit entrypoint 23 select : Enabled AVOID
...
32-bit entrypoint 76 getrlimit : Enabled
32-bit entrypoint 191 getrlimit : Enabled
64-bit entrypoint 97 getrlimit : Enabled
...

And seems only two of them syscalls are using in testing; I'm using "Latest
release is v1.2, released on Jul 22nd 2013" on CentOS6.4, not sure it's my
test bed issue, please help to check.
